To provide a coated and heat-treated steel material which has appropriate corrosion resistance after having been painted as an automotive member and can suppress the production of scale due to heat treatment, even when having been subjected to the heat treatment of heating at least a part of a steel material having a plated film on at least one side to a quenchable temperature range and subsequently cooling it.
The coated and heat-treated steel material is formed by conducting the heat treatment of heating at least a part of the steel material having the plated film of an aluminum-based alloy on at least one side to the quenchable temperature range, and has a film in which iron and aluminum are alloyed, on the surface of at least one part of a portion that has been heat-treated. The film has corrosion resistance and also can secure a lubricating function at a high temperature.
